ABILENE — Columbus, Schulenburg, Brazos, and Flatonia High Schools all had powerlifters participate in the state powerlifting meet March 24 at the Taylor County Expo Center in Abilene, with lifters from two of the schools crowning themselves as state champions.
Brazos powerlifter Kasey Zientek won the 3A title in the 220 weight class with a squat of 650, bench press of 455, and deadlift of 605 for a total of 1,710. The other powerlifter with a state crown is Flatonia lifter Taden Alvarado in the 2A division and SHW weight class. Alvarado posted a 800 squat, 400 bench press, and 575 deadlift for a total of 1,775.
Other state powerlifters from Flatonia include Gentry Doyle in the 132 weight class with a 315 squat, 215 bench press, and 335 deadlift for a 865 total. Flatonia lifter Davon Walles from the 308 weight class scored a 610 squat, 370 bench press, and 500 deadlift for a total of 1,480.
